Abstract

The utility model discloses a windproof umbrella, which comprises an umbrella stay bar, wherein an umbrella handle is arranged at the bottom of the umbrella stay bar, a pushing sleeve and a sliding sleeve are slidably mounted on the umbrella stay bar, a fixed sleeve is fixedly mounted on the umbrella stay bar, a main umbrella rib is mounted on one side of the fixed sleeve through a rotating mounting piece, a first umbrella rib support is mounted on one side of the pushing sleeve through the rotating mounting piece, a second umbrella rib support is mounted on one side of the sliding sleeve through the rotating mounting piece, the other end of the second umbrella rib support is sleeved on the main umbrella rib through a sliding mounting head in a manner of moving left and right, the sliding mounting head is positioned between two limiting blocks on the main umbrella rib, and the other end of the first umbrella rib support is rotatably mounted on the second umbrella rib support. Background
The umbrella is a tool for shading sun or rain and snow, the framework in the umbrella surface is upwards supported to enable the umbrella to be supported, but in the existing umbrella, the umbrella surfaces of most umbrellas are likely to be overturned under the condition that wind power is high, and then people are likely to be in a rainy state.

Detailed Description
The technical solutions in the embodiments of the present invention will be clearly and completely described below with reference to the drawings in the embodiments of the present invention, and it is obvious that the described embodiments are only a part of the embodiments of the present invention, and not all of the embodiments. All other embodiments, which can be obtained by a person skilled in the art without making any creative effort based on the embodiments in the present invention, belong to the protection scope of the present invention.
Referring to fig. 1-3, the present invention provides a technical solution: a windproof umbrella, as shown in fig. 1 and fig. 2, the bottom of the umbrella stay bar 1 is equipped with the umbrella handle 2, the umbrella stay bar 1 is slidably equipped with the push sleeve 3 and the sliding sleeve 4, the spring 5 is arranged between the push sleeve 3 and the sliding sleeve 4, and the spring 5 is sleeved on the umbrella stay bar 1, and the two ends of the spring 5 are respectively fixed on the push sleeve 3 and the sliding sleeve 4, when the push sleeve 3 is pushed upwards, the sliding sleeve 4 is driven by the spring 5 to move upwards together, which is convenient for the second umbrella frame 12 to open, the umbrella stay bar 1 between the sliding sleeve 4 and the fixed sleeve 6 is also sleeved with the spring 5, and the top of the spring 5 is fixedly connected with the bottom of the fixed sleeve 6, which is convenient for the spring 5 to accumulate potential energy after the umbrella is opened and fixed, and the umbrella cover is automatically contracted when the umbrella is closed by the potential energy, the push sleeve 3 is equipped with the push ring 14 and the closing button, one side of the push ring 14 located on the closing button is equipped with an opening, the push ring 14 is utilized to enable the push sleeve 3 to have a force application point, so that the push effect is convenient to improve, and meanwhile, the design of the opening enables the closing button to be easily found by fingers, so that the umbrella is more convenient to close when being used at night.
As shown in fig. 1 and fig. 3, a fixed sleeve 6 is fixedly installed on an umbrella support rod 1, a main umbrella rib 8 is installed on one side of the fixed sleeve 6 through a rotating installation part 13, a telescopic water receiving sleeve 7 is also installed on the top of the umbrella support rod 1, a water discharging head 701 on the top of the telescopic water receiving sleeve 7 is in threaded connection with a threaded head 101 on the top of the umbrella support rod 1, the main body of the telescopic water receiving sleeve 7 is a sleeve with a diameter decreasing in sequence, rainwater on an umbrella cover is conveniently received through the telescopic water receiving sleeve 7, rainwater is prevented from wetting clean ground, a first umbrella rib support 11 is installed on one side of a pushing sleeve 3 through the rotating installation part 13, a second umbrella rib support 12 is installed on one side of a sliding sleeve 4 through the rotating installation part 13, the other end of the second umbrella rib support 12 is sleeved on the main umbrella rib 8 in a manner that the sliding installation part 10 can move left and right, the sliding installation part 10 is located between two limit blocks 9 on the main umbrella rib 8, the other end of the first umbrella rib support 11 is rotatably installed on the second umbrella rib support 12, the main umbrella rib 8, the first umbrella rib support 11 and the second umbrella rib support 12 form a group of umbrella rib components, and the umbrella rib components are provided with eight to twelve groups, so that the integral strength of the umbrella rib components is improved.
When the umbrella is used, the pushing ring 14 drives the pushing sleeve 3 to slide upwards, the pushing sleeve 3 drives the sliding sleeve 4 to move upwards through the spring 5, when the pushing sleeve 3 is clamped, the spring 5 at the bottom of the fixing sleeve 6 is compressed, and when the umbrella is folded, the spring 5 at the bottom of the fixing sleeve 6 can provide potential energy to enable the umbrella cover to automatically contract.
